Yesterday I came across a nice detail, by accident: When you begin to drag an interaction noodle, if you hold the OPTION key on Mac while dragging, the interaction will change into a Swap overlay interaction. This allows me to create Swap overlays very quickly indeed. Why not add more of these, for instance holding SHIFT could make it a Open overlay interaction, etc. In that example, the interaction settings popover would still open because Open overlay has a number of options I may want to tune, but at least the interaction type (Open overlay) would be already set in the dropdown. Those are tiny details, but we do those actions millions of times a day…
The ability to use a ternary operator in variable expressions would make dramatically increase the ways that variables and expressions could be used. Beyond that the current conditional action only allows for a binary set of options but since ternary expressions could be nested we could effectively have elseif conditions. They are a native operator for JS so I would think it wouldn’t be too much of a stretch to add them in.

Currently when you click a link to a frame within the same file you’re instantly moved to that frame, which is great! The issue is, especially with big files, you can get lost on where you were just moved and have to zoom out to get your bearings again. An animation from the link to the destination frame would help you understand where you’re coming from and where you’re going.

Right now, when you are exploring your file, you can hold the middle mouse button to go in some pan mode, where you grab and move the canvas. Other 2D graphics software offer this functionality aswell, though some have it on spacebar per default. In my favorite photo editing suite the user can not only pan the canvas, but also zoom by scrolling the mouse wheel in this mode. I’d love to see this functionality in Figma aswell. Currently in Figma one would have to hold crtl additionally to the middle mouse button. This is somewhat inconvenient, because you need to use both hands and it’s most likely bad for accessibility too.
